Sabbatical 2007-2008 Reading and Review

The reading that I am selecting for this 2007-2008 sabbatical will reflect the learning projects in which I have become involved. My goal is to deepen my understanding through the thoughts of others so that I might reflect and develop some of my own thoughts.  I have categorized my reading in five areas:  spiritual formation and direction, men’s issues, care ministry, parish leadership and development, and, interesting stuff (which is where I put all of the fun books that didn’t fit any other category).
